What is the role of Provisional Detention Centers in the Brazilian prison system?
Provisional Detention Centers are penitentiary establishments intended to house people in preventive detention during the criminal process, providing adequate accommodation conditions and respecting their fundamental rights while guaranteeing the safety and effectiveness of the investigation.
